WebTack strips are used to keep the carpet taut (to prevent bunching) as well as holding it in place at the edges. Without tack strips, the carpet will move around. Installers also use adhesive spread all over to help keep the carpet from moving as well. Unless you want nail holes, and adhesive on the wood floor, leave it alone. WebSep 13, 2024 · Carpet tack strips are narrow lengths of wood, usually Douglas fir, that are used to keep the wall-to-wall carpet in place.
